Irvine Ranch Water District pays $3.00 per square foot to Irvine homeowners who replace thirsty lawn, on at least 250 square feet.
The Irvine turf removal rebate
Turf Replacement Program, run by Irvine Ranch Water District.
$3.00 per square foot
- Most California programs run on the Metropolitan Water District regional base rate, and your retail agency may add to it
- Between 250 and 5,000 square feet per property per year
- Apply and receive approval before removing any turf
Apply and get approval before you remove any grass. This program does not pay retroactively.

Does Irvine, CA offer a turf removal rebate?
Yes. Irvine Ranch Water District runs the Turf Replacement Program, paying $3.00 per square foot. You must remove at least 250 square feet to qualify. Full conditions are on the Irvine Ranch Water District rebate page.
How much is the Irvine turf rebate actually worth on a typical lawn?
At Irvine Ranch Water District's rate of $3.00 per square foot, removing a 600 square foot lawn returns $1,800. A 1,000 square foot lawn returns $3,000.
